Go through the step-by-step instructions on how to Adopt E-Signature Tolling Agreement online with pdfFiller:
Add the form for eSignature to pdfFiller from your device or cloud storage.
As soon as the file opens in the editor, click Sign in the top toolbar.
Generate your electronic signature by typing, drawing, or adding your handwritten signature's image from your laptop. Then, click Save and sign.
Click anywhere on a document to Adopt E-Signature Tolling Agreement. You can drag it around or resize it utilizing the controls in the floating panel. To use your signature, click OK.
Complete the signing process by hitting DONE below your document or in the top right corner.
Next, you'll return to the pdfFiller dashboard. From there, you can download a signed copy, print the document, or send it to other parties for review or validation.
